Gamespark Tabuk is a premier gaming hub in Saudi Arabia. With their state-of-the-art facilities and extensive selection of games, Gamespark Tabuk is your perfect place to kill some time with squad. Whether you're a https://minaxrnu728561.gynoblog.com/profile